Filipa Pato Nossa Missão Baga Pre-Phylloxera

Filipa Pato Nossa Missão Baga Pré-Filoxera is a wine of great purity and depth, originating from vines over 150 years old. The notes of violets and strawberry evolve after a few years into extreme complexity, with great energy and concentration. The acidity is lively and the tannins silky, exhibiting great persistence and elegance.

    Filipa Pato Nossa Missão Baga Pre-Phylloxera

    Grape varieties: Baga (Vines over 150 years old pre-phylloxera).
    Vinification: Meticulous manual selection, partial destemming, with the use of whole bunches depending on the vintage. Fermentation with indigenous yeasts, daily pigeage for 3 weeks and first pressing by gravity, followed by slow and gentle pressing to obtain an exceptionally pure wine.
    Aging: 18 months in traditional kite flying.
    Colour: Intense and bright dark red.
    Aroma: Violets and strawberries when the wine is young. After 7 to 9 years, these aromas become extremely complex, with a lot of energy and concentration.
    Flavour: The tannins are smooth, yet very lively, silky and velvety, combining with the vivacity of the acidity, in addition to being persistent, elegant and refreshing.


    Serve: 16-18⁰
    Consumption: Immediate or storage (35 years).


    Harmonisation: Refined game meats, pigeon, duck, filet mignon or veal, cooked offal, never too spicy. Creamy cheeses with an intense flavor.
